HOFFMAN PLAYED MATCHMAKER FOR PORTMAN

NATALIE PORTMAN will never forget the first time she met screen legend DUSTIN HOFFMAN - he tried to set her up with his son.
Portman, who stars alongside the movie great in new family film Mr.
Magorium’s Wonder Emporium, was appearing in a play 10 years ago when Hoffman came backstage and introduced himself.
And the two-time Oscar winner wasted no time in igetting the actress to talk to his son on the telephone.
She recalls, "I was doing a play in New York and he came backstage and was so, so lovely - and put me on the phone with his son.
"His son is lovely but wasn’t interested in me, (although) Dustin was interested in adopting me into his family."
